There are loads of football podcasts and my favourite was Baker and Lineker's 'Behind Closed Doors'. After that podcast closed its doors for good I looked around for an alternative and found 'Famous Sloping Pitch'. I'm glad I did. After a couple of only 'okay' early episodes it really finds its feet. It's excellent.

Nick Hancock and Chris England are two slightly curmudgeonly, old school footie fans lamenting the changes in the game. 'Famous Sloping Pitch' is a mix of opinion, the anecdotal, and the topical with both performers coming across as knowledgeable and passionate about the game. Each episode features a different guest so obviously the humour quaotient can vary from week to week, but thankfully, so far, the great episodes have easily outweighed the merely good. Definitely one to follow.
